局文件或者代碼來創建用戶界面。Android平臺使用的是XML布局文件,開發者可以在布局文件中定義各種控件和布局方式。iOS平臺使用的是故事板和自動布局,開發者可以通過拖拽和調整控件的位置和大小來創建用戶界面。
數據處理是App開發中的另一個重要方面。開發者可以使用數據庫來存儲和管理數據。常見的數據庫包括SQLite和Core Data。開發者可以使用SQL語句或者對象關系映射(ORM)框架來操作數據庫。
網絡通信是App開發中必不可少的一部分。開發者可以使用HTTP協議來進行網絡通信。常見的網絡APP開發通信框架包括OkHttp和AFNetworking。開發者可以使用這些框架來發送HTTP請求和接收響應,從而實現與服務器的數據交互。
最后,App開發完成后,開發者需要進行測試和調試。可以使用模擬器或者真實設備來測試App的功能和性能。開發者還可以使用調試工具來查找和修復Bug。
總結起來,App開發需要具備一定的編程知識和技能,需要有一個開發環境,需要編寫代碼實現功能,需要進行用戶界面設計、數據處理和網絡通信,最后需要進行測試和調試。通過不斷學習和實踐,開發者可以不斷提升自己的App開發能力,創造出更加優秀和實用的應用程序。